- What does Evidence Cleaner do?
Many people do not realize that the Windows operating system, Internet
browsers as well many other programs store useless and redundant information on
your hard drive. Not only does this information affect your computer performance
by eating up needed hard drive space, but it can also pose a serious risk to your
privacy. When someone accesses your computer, whether it's a hacker from the outside
or someone sitting at your desk, they can use this information to find out what
documents you have used, which pictures you have viewed, what web sites you have
visited and much more. Evidence Cleaner cleans out all of this loose information,
protecting your privacy and keeping your system at peak performance.

- How to install Plug-Ins?
[1] Open Evidence Cleaner.
[2] Click "Plug-In Items" button to switch to the Plug-In tab sheet.
[3] Click "Import Plug-Ins" button.
[4] Select a Plug-In from your hard drive you want to install.
[5] Click the "Open" button from the Open Dialog.

- How to remove a Plug-In?
[1] Open Evidence Cleaner.
[2] Click "Plug-In Items" button to switch to the Plug-In tab sheet.
[3] Right-click a Plug-In title from Plug-In list.
[4] Select "Remove this Plug-In Item".

- How do I uninstall Evidence Cleaner?
Step 1. Open Evidence Cleaner.
Step 2. Click "About" button.
Step 3. Click "Uninstall" button.
